A remodel begins long before demolition

The initial phase of any successful remodel is not turning a hammer. It is exploration. Good basic service providers Denver home owners depend on spend actual time understanding your home, the range, the wish list, and the non-negotiables. They would like to know exactly how you utilize the area, what bothers you now, what degree of finish you expect, and where your spending plan ceiling sits. If you have never ever remodeled in the past, this component can feel slower than you really hoped. It is really the phase that saves one of the most cash later.

A solid professional will certainly walk the building thoroughly, not delicately. They will certainly consider access, ceiling heights, mechanical places, panel ability, window conditions, drain around the structure, and evidence of previous remodels. In Denver, that persistance matters since many homes have actually been modified several times. It is not uncommon to open up a wall and find plumbing rerouted in a manner that would certainly never ever pass current code, or framework modifications that require correction prior to brand-new job can continue.

This is also where expectations obtain adjusted. An experienced Contractor Denver carbon monoxide home owners can count on will tell you what is feasible, what is high-risk, and what is likely to cost more than you think. If you want to move a kitchen area throughout the house, they will certainly discuss the result on pipes, airing vent, electrical, flooring repair work, and potentially structural work. If you desire a flush beam of light where a bearing wall currently stands, they ought to review design, short-lived assistance, evaluation timing, and coating patching, not just throw out a one-line number.

That honesty deserves paying for.

What a great quote must actually inform you

Price is the number property owners infatuate on first, but range clearness is usually more vital. One proposal can be reduced just since it omits permits, prep work, finish woodworking, debris carrying, or basic allocations that are unrealistically slim. This is where lots of people obtain melted. They contrast totals, not the compound inside them.

When you evaluate proposals from Structure Contractors Denver clients are thinking about, search for information. You wish to see what is consisted of, what is left out, what presumptions the rate depends on, and where allowances apply. An allowance is not a guarantee of your last price. It is a placeholder. If your bathroom vanity allocation is $1,200 and you pick one that costs $2,100, you pay the distinction. That appears evident, however when a task includes ceramic tile, pipes components, devices, cupboard hardware, lights, kitchen counters, and flooring, tiny allowance voids stack up fast.

The ideal Colorado General Contractors generally explain cost in layers. There is the noticeable coating work everyone notices, after that there is the surprise job that frequently eats even more labor than anticipated. Demolition, framing corrections, subfloor progressing, code upgrades, air duct reroutes, and patching are not attractive, but they are commonly the backbone of a remodel. A trustworthy quote represent those facts as opposed to wishing they disappear.

The routine will feel straight theoretically and messy in real life

Homeowners love timelines since they create assurance. Professionals know that improvement rarely behaves in a straight line. A schedule can and need to exist, however it ought to be dealt with as a working file rather than a rigid promise.

A well-run remodel has a rational flow. Design and selections need to be finished before ordering. Materials need to get here before installment. Demo needs to occur before mounting modifications show up. Harsh pipes, electric, and cooling and heating require to be full before insulation and drywall. Closets normally require the room effectively determined and prepped prior to they can be installed easily. Painters, ceramic tile setters, finish carpenters, counter top makers, and home appliance installers all depend on the job prior to them being done right.

That appears organized, and often it is, till actual homes intervene. A basement bath might expose a slab concern that transforms drainpipe routing. A kitchen wall might have a vent pile nobody accounted for. The cupboard preparation might wander from 8 weeks to twelve. The countertop template consultation may move because the final closet set up is one day behind. Good General Getting Services Denver teams do not claim these points never occur. They prepare buffers where they can and connect early when they cannot.

One of the clearest indicators of specialist job management is not an excellent timetable. It is steady, reputable interaction about the schedule.

What living via the remodel in fact really feels like

Most property owners take too lightly the interruption. A remodel is not simply construction taking place in your residence. It alters daily routines, access, personal privacy, sound degrees, storage space, and even how you make coffee in the morning.

Kitchen remodels are specifically disruptive due to the fact that they eliminate your major energy area. For weeks, possibly longer, your sink, variety, and food storage may be compromised. Restroom remodels appear smaller, yet shedding a primary bathroom produces stress swiftly, specifically for family members with tight early morning timetables. Whole-home tasks can transform regular life right into a series of short-lived workarounds.

A capable Denver General Specialist ought to help you prepare for that fact instead of lessening it. They ought to talk about dust control, work hours, website access, debris removal, parking, animal safety and security, and whether portions of the home will be off-limits. In older Denver homes, dust control should have unique interest due to the fact that plaster, old finishes, and tight spaces can make control more difficult than in brand-new construction.

Here are a couple of facts worth planning for before work begins:

Noise will get here earlier and feel sharper than you expect, particularly throughout demolition, floor tile removal, and framing. Dust will take a trip beyond the work area unless the staff uses disciplined containment and cleaning practices. Decision fatigue is real, because also a moderate remodel can need loads of finish and field choices. Your routine will certainly decrease, from dish prep to laundry accessibility to where deliveries can be dropped. Small hold-ups feel larger when you are living inside the job, which is why communication matters so much.

That checklist is not implied to frighten you off. It is indicated to maintain you from strolling in blind. Improvement goes a lot more efficiently when the trouble is prepared for instead of treated as a surprise.

Change orders are not always a red flag

Homeowners typically hear "change order" and assume something has actually failed. Sometimes it has. Often the initial scope was badly recorded or the contractor underbid the job. However lots of modification orders are reputable and unavoidable.

If you open a wall and find water damages around an old home window, that repair was not optional. If your electrical panel has no ability for the updated kitchen you want, a modification might be necessary. If you determine midway via the project that you want wider slab flooring carried right into surrounding areas, that is likewise an adjustment. The problem is not whether adjustments happen. The issue is whether they are priced clearly, warranted honestly, and accepted before the work proceeds.

Professional Contractors in Colorado typically record adjustments in writing with labor, product, and routine implications spelled out. That safeguards both sides. You prevent getting hit with fuzzy end-of-job fees. The service provider stays clear of doing extra work on a spoken guarantee that later on becomes a dispute.

A remodel without any adjustments can take place, but it is not the standard, especially in older homes.

Subcontractors, guidance, and why the team can alter from week to week

Many property owners expect one stable team from beginning to end. In remodeling, that is rarely just how it functions. A Lot Of Denver Contractors Solutions procedures rely upon a mix of internal labor and specialty subcontractors. You may see demo crews, framers, electrical contractors, plumbings, HVAC technologies, drywall finishers, cupboard installers, painters, floor tile setters, and floor covering groups at various phases. That does not mean the project lacks control. In a good system, it means each trade is brought in when their competence is needed.

What matters is supervision. A trustworthy General Contractor Denver must not merely hand off your job and go away. Someone requires to work with sequencing, confirm quality, validate dimensions, examine prep job prior to the next trade begins, and catch errors while they are still economical to fix. Poor supervision is often where remodels untangle. Tile obtains installed prior to a shower niche is effectively blocked. Closet dimensions are not checked versus final device specs. Drywall appearance takes place prior to low-voltage adjustments are complete. Each mistake creates cost, hold-up, and frustration.

The finest Denver Specialist Services suppliers run active oversight also if the proprietor is not literally on-site every hour. They use website visits, superintendent check-ins, images, shared updates, and punch tracking to keep criteria high.

Budget pressure points that catch people off guard

Most remodel budget plans obtain squeezed in the exact same few areas. Coatings are a huge one. People begin with affordable choices, after that they walk right into a floor tile showroom, touch a handmade zellige sample, and instantly the allowance is gone. The very same occurs with pipes components, custom-made glass, integrated illumination, and appliance upgrades.

The other typical stress factor is surprise conditions. Old homes bring unknowns. Floorings might run out degree enough to impact cupboards. Existing home windows may require trim or insulation job to tie into the remodel easily. Previous remodels might have missed vital details that now need adjustment. This is particularly appropriate when dealing with older real estate supply common across Denver.

A smart professional will certainly speak about contingency, not to pad the task, but to show fact. On several remodels, especially older homes or jobs involving architectural or layout adjustments, reserving a contingency can avoid a difficult scramble later on. The exact percentage depends upon scope and house problem, but the principle remains the very same: reserve money for things you can not see yet.

Quality control turns up in the details you do not see at first

Most house owners can spot attractive finishes. Less understand https://elliotbkav905.iamarrows.com/why-denver-service-provider-provider-issue-for-growing-companies-and-properties what sustains them. A tidy tile set up depends upon level substratum, cautious layout, crisp waterproofing, and appropriate changes. A cupboard run looks expensive when the wall surfaces are dealt with, exposes correspond, fillers are thoughtful, and home appliances fit without awkward spaces. Repaint looks abundant when prep is meticulous. A basement feels warm and finished when insulation, air securing, and moisture monitoring were dealt with appropriately prior to trim ever before went in.

That is the distinction between a remodel that photographs well on day one and one that still really feels solid years later.

Experienced Colorado Specialists additionally recognize where not to reduce edges. Waterproofing in showers, home window blinking details, architectural fastening, electric rough-ins, and air flow are not the places to conserve a couple of hundred dollars. Shortcuts there come to be leakages, callbacks, and costly repairs. The very best Colorado General Professionals construct for sturdiness as much as appearance.
